Nestled in the southeastern corner of Wisconsin, Oak Creek is a charming city that offers a delightful blend of suburban tranquility and urban convenience. Located just south of Milwaukee, it provides easy access to the bustling city life while maintaining its own unique charm. With a population of approximately 36,000 residents, Oak Creek is known for its welcoming community and scenic landscapes, making it an ideal location for individuals of all ages, including seniors.

One of the city's highlights is the beautiful Bender Park, which offers picturesque views of Lake Michigan and a variety of out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ing, and picnicking. The city's commitment to green spaces and recreational facilities is evident in its well-maintained parks and trails, providing ample opportunities for relaxation and leisure.

For those interested in cultural and historical attractions, Oak Creek does not disappoint. The city is home to the Drexel Town Square, a vibrant hub that combines shopping, dining, and entertainment options, creating a lively atmosphere for residents and visitors alike. Additionally, the nearby Milwaukee County Historical Society offers insights into the rich history of the region.

Oak Creek is particularly suitable for seniors, thanks to its peaceful neighborhoods, excellent healthcare facilities, and a strong sense of community. The city's infrastructure supports an active lifestyle, with various programs and services tailored to senior citizens.

Assisted Living Costs in Oak Creek, Wisconsin

When considering assisted living options in Oak Creek, Wisconsin, understanding the costs involved is crucial for making an informed decision. The median monthly cost of assisted living in Wisconsin is approximately $5,500, as reported by Genworth's Cost of Care Study. However, Oak Creek offers a slightly more affordable option, with average monthly expenses around $4,421. This variance can be attributed to factors such as location, amenities, and the level of care provided.

Oak Creek's strategic location near healthcare facilities like Ascension SE Wisconsin Hospital-Franklin Campus and Midwest Orthopedic Specialty Hospital ensures that residents have access to essential medical services, which is a significant consideration when evaluating assisted living options. The proximity to these hospitals can provide peace of mind to both residents and their families, knowing that medical attention is readily available when needed.

For those concerned about the financial burden of assisted living, it's worth exploring government support programs that may be available in Oak Creek. While specific local programs should be verified with local agencies, Wisconsin offers several statewide initiatives that can assist with the costs associated with assisted living. Programs such as Family Care and IRIS (Include, Respect, I Self-Direct) are designed to help eligible individuals gain access to necessary services.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Oak Creek, Wisconsin

Choosing the right senior living option in Oak Creek, Wisconsin, can be a daunting task, given the variety of facilities available. Understanding the differences between assisted living, memory care, nursing homes, and independent living can help families make informed decisions.

Assisted living facilities in Oak Creek offer a blend of independence and support. Residents typically have their own apartments and receive ass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. These facilities often provide social activities and communal dining, fostering a sense of community.

Memory care units are specialized sections within assisted living facilities or standalone centers designed for individuals with Alzheimer's and other forms of dementia. They offer a higher level of supervision and structured activities tailored to cognitive needs, ensuring safety and enhancing quality of life.

Nursing homes, also known as skilled nursing facilities, provide the most intensive level of care. They are equipped to handle complex medical needs, offering 24-hour nursing care and rehabilitation services. Residents often have chronic illnesses or disabilities that require constant medical attention.

Independent living is ideal for seniors who are self-sufficient but seek a community environment. These facilities offer amenities such as housekeeping, transportation, and recreational activities, allowing residents to enjoy a maintenance-free lifestyle while remaining active and engaged.

In Oak Creek, the choice between these options depends on the individual's health needs, lifestyle preferences, and financial considerations. Each facility type offers unique benefits, and understanding these differences is crucial in selecting the most suitable environment for a loved one. Whether seeking the autonomy of independent living or the specialized support of memory care, Oak Creek provides a range of options to meet diverse needs.

How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Oak Creek, Wisconsin

Qualifying for assisted living in Oak Creek, Wisconsin, involves several key considerations and steps to ensure that potential residents receive the appropriate level of care and support. Understanding these requirements can help streamline the process for individuals and families seeking assisted living options.

To qualify for assisted living in Oak Creek, individuals typically must demonstrate a need for assistance with daily living activities. This can include help with bathing, dressing, medication management, and meal preparation. A comprehensive assessment by a healthcare professional is often required to determine the level of care needed.

Financial considerations play a significant role in qualifying for assisted living. Prospective residents should evaluate their financial resources, including savings, pensions, and any long-term care insurance policies. For those who may require financial assistance, government programs such as Medicaid can be invaluable. In Wisconsin, the Medicaid program may cover some assisted living costs for eligible individuals through the Family Care or IRIS (Include, Respect, I Self-Direct) programs. These programs are designed to support seniors and individuals with disabilities by providing funding for necessary services.

Applicants should also consider the specific requirements of individual assisted living facilities in Oak Creek. Each facility may have its own criteria, including age restrictions and health assessments, so it is important to contact facilities directly to understand their specific admission processes.

To improve the chances of qualifying, individuals can gather all necessary medical records and financial documents in advance. Additionally, consulting with a local elder law attorney or a financial advisor specializing in senior care can provide valuable guidance on navigating the qualification process.

By understanding these requirements and preparing accordingly, individuals and families can better position themselves to secure a place in an assisted living facility in Oak Creek, ensuring a supportive and caring environment for their loved ones.

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Oak Creek, Wisconsin

Assisted living facilities in Oak Creek, Wisconsin, offer a range of benefits and challenges that families should consider when deciding on the best care options for their loved ones.

One of the primary advantages of choosing assisted living in Oak Creek is the community's serene environment. Nestled in a suburban area, Oak Creek provides a peaceful setting that is ideal for seniors seeking a quiet lifestyle. The city is known for its friendly community, which helps foster a sense of belonging for residents. Additionally, Oak Creek's proximity to Milwaukee offers easy access to comprehensive healthcare services, cultural activities, and shopping centers, ensuring that residents have everything they need within reach.

Assisted living facilities in Oak Creek also offer personalized care tailored to individual needs. This includes ass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management, all provided by trained staff. Many facilities also provide a range of social and recreational activities designed to keep residents engaged and active, promoting both physical and mental well-being.

However, there are some disadvantages to consider. The cost of assisted living in Oak Creek can be significant, with monthly fees varying depending on the level of care and amenities offered. Families should carefully evaluate their financial situation and explore available options for financial assistance. Additionally, while Oak Creek offers a peaceful environment, some residents may find it lacking in the vibrant social scene found in larger cities, potentially leading to feelings of isolation.

In summary, assisted living in Oak Creek, Wisconsin, offers a supportive and tranquil environment with personalized care, but potential residents and their families should weigh these benefits against the costs and consider the social opportunities available.
